Egg mashala curry

The ingredients we needed to cook it...

Boiled eggs - 4
Onion - 2 in big size (crushed in mixer)
Tomato - 2 big sizes (crushed in mixer)
Ginger and Garlic paste - 2 tea spoon
Turmeric powder - tea spoon
Salt - as per the taste
Green chilies - 3/4
Curry leaves - 7/8 leaves
Cumin seeds - 1 tea spoon
Coriander powder - 2 tea spoon
Cumin powder - 2 tea spoon
Garam mashala - 1 tea spoon
Kasmiri Lal mirch - 1 tea spoon
Red chili powder- 1/2 tea spoon
Coriander leaves - 2 tea spoon (finely chopped)
Oil - refined                  
Water - 4 cup

Now let’s get start to cook... at first peel off the boil egg and with the help of knife make 3 or 4 mark / lining over the egg very gently so that u won't get hurt while frying it... sometimes while frying, it may suddenly burst out ...anyways let’s begin, turn on the flame on the medium heat take a pan and wait to warm it then get 3 table spoon oil and wait to heat then give some salt, turmeric powder and get the egg on it and fry it till it becomes brown color then get the fried egg back to the plate then in  remaining oil add 2 tea spoon more oil then after warming up give some curry leaves in it stir it for 5 second then take in to the crushed onion fry until it becomes brown then add ginger and garlic paste, salt to taste, turmeric powder, green chilies and fry it for 5 minute then add the crushed tomatoes and again fry it for 5 min after that we will add coriander and cumin powder and sprinkle the water if needed so that mashala will not get burn and stir it for 7 to 8 minute add garam mashala and again fry it for 5 minutes and add water and wait to boil it after boiling gravy leave the fried egg carefully then mix it with gravy and again stir it for 3 to 4 minute..Then turn the flame off and spread the coriander leaves and serve it...
